<p>I assume you are talking about transferring colleges. No, you cannot sent a copy of your transcript yourself. You can request an official transcript from your current school and they could give that to you in a sealed envelop, which you can then send to the college you are applying. Sometimes a school will send it directly to the college for your, so you need find out for your college what their process is. You may even be able to request a transcript online or via email.</p>

<p>Yes, if your college sends the official (sealed) transcript to your house, you then mail that to the college you are applying. When my D transferred, she ordered 3, as she didn’t know how many colleges she would be applying, and when they came it was clear that the first large envelop was the shipping envelop, the next envelop contained the 3 sealed transcripts. She took one of the sealed transcripts and dropped it into its own envelop with a short note to admissions. You don’t need to also ask your school to send one direct to the new college if you are forwarding them a sealed hardcopy.</p>
